How to Market a Shopify App in 2026: 7 Channels

A practical channel map for Shopify app growth: App Store visibility, product loops, content, partnerships, paid acquisition, and direct merchant outreach.

How to Market a Shopify App in 2026: 7 Channels
TL;DR

Start with product activation and App Store conversion. Add content, partnerships, paid acquisition, and merchant outreach only when the app's price, retention, and ideal merchant profile can support them.

Marketing a Shopify app is not one tactic. App Store visibility captures existing demand, product loops turn users into distribution, content educates merchants, partnerships transfer trust, and outbound can open conversations with a narrow merchant segment. The right mix depends on your price point, sales motion, and retention.

Know the terrain first

The Shopify App Store is a discovery and conversion channel governed by Shopify's current listing, eligibility, and ranking systems. Before adding acquisition channels, confirm that your listing clearly explains the merchant problem, onboarding reaches value quickly, and retained users match the segment you plan to acquire. Shopify documents its current visibility requirements and listing best practices.

The standard channels, honestly rated

Marketplace optimization

Use accurate category positioning, clear screenshots, a concise value proposition, and responsive support. Treat the listing as both a discovery surface and the conversion page merchants may revisit after hearing about the app elsewhere.

Content and SEO

Writing for the problems your app solves builds authority over quarters, not weeks. Worth doing, never a this-quarter plan. The channel math is in our lead generation breakdown.

Partnerships

Agencies and complementary tools referring you is powerful and painfully slow to build. Referral pipelines mature in quarters and concentrate risk in a few relationships.

Paid acquisition

Bidding on merchant keywords means bidding against every funded competitor in your category. It converts existing demand at a price; it rarely creates demand for a newer app economically.

Direct outreach to fitting merchants

Direct outreach lets you choose which merchants to contact and test a message without waiting for marketplace rankings. It is most appropriate when the app solves a high-value problem for a recognizable store segment and a conversation improves the buying decision. A low-priced utility with instant self-serve activation may be better served by listing conversion, onboarding, content, or product-led distribution.

The buyers are Shopify and Shopify Plus merchants, from one-person DTC stores to nine-figure brands. Their stores are public, which means your exact ideal customers are identifiable:

  • Stores already running a competing or complementary app to yours
  • Ad libraries showing active paid spend, meaning budget exists
  • Product launch cadence and catalog growth, meaning operational pain is live
  • Review velocity and order-volume proxies that match your ideal customer profile

Outreach that merchants read instead of deleting

Useful research starts with public, verifiable context such as store category, catalog, geography, current offers, and observable site features. Treat technology detection and business estimates as hypotheses, not facts. The message should connect one relevant observation to the problem the app solves without pretending to know private performance data.

The mechanics are the same ones we document in how to write a cold email: one store-specific observation, one relevant problem sentence, one proof point, one five-word ask. Sent from warmed dedicated domains, never your product domain, with the discipline covered in the deliverability guide.

The objection worth answering

"Merchants only install from the App Store." The App Store remains the installation path for many public apps, but discovery and evaluation can happen elsewhere. A short, relevant conversation may help when implementation, stakeholder buy-in, or expected commercial value needs explanation.

Frequently asked questions

What is the fastest way to market a Shopify app?

There is no universal fastest channel. Improve activation and listing conversion first. Direct outreach can be quick to test when the app has a narrow merchant segment and enough value to justify a conversation; low-priced utilities may grow faster through marketplace discovery and product loops.

How do I get more installs from the Shopify App Store?

Follow the platform's current listing rules, make the merchant problem obvious, use accurate screenshots, reduce time to value, and support users well. Then use content, partnerships, or outreach to create qualified visits to the listing.

Does cold email work for reaching Shopify merchants?

It can when the segment is identifiable, the message uses verified public context, and the app solves a commercially meaningful problem. Terrific Live is one approved ecommerce-software example; results vary by offer, market, data quality, and execution.
